    What you'll be doing?
     
    You’ll be assisting the Mason Team Leader with day‑to‑day tasks, supporting them in planning, preparing, and carrying out site activities to ensure work is completed efficiently, safely, and to the required standard.
     

    You’ll be laying flags, kerbs, concrete, and block paving, taking responsibility for preparing the ground, setting accurate levels, and ensuring all materials are installed to a high-quality finish that meets project specifications.

    You’ll be using a petrol cut‑off saw as part of your duties, operating the equipment safely and precisely to cut materials to size while following all relevant safety procedures and maintaining control of the work area.
